So I moved to a new house and after 2 days my PSU died (HX620). I bought a new one (CX750M) and it started doing a weird cricket noise and I could feel an electric field all over the components and when I touch any conductor part I get mini shocks.
I thought the PSU was defective so I returned it and bought a new one (RM650X) but after a day it started making the same noise and the electric field was there too.
I tried connecting it to a different plug and buying a new power strip but the issue continues.

The sound is really high and I can barely listen to anything without headphones.
